US Teens Experience Seoul, South Korea for the First Time

What happens when a group of American teens spends three days exploring Seoul, South Korea for the very first time? In this episode we take you beyond the K-pop stereotypes and into the heart of one of the world's most fascinating cities. From ancient palaces to bustling markets, incredible food, and powerful history. Seoul constantly surprised us. PART 1: SEOUL MOVES FAST Our adventure begins with the energy of modern Seoul. We take in the incredible views from Namsan Seoul Tower, explore the trendy streets and cafes of Ikseon-dong, wander through the neon lights and shopping paradise of Myeong-dong, and discover why Seoul is one of the most exciting cities in the world. PART 2: TRADITIONAL SEOUL Next, we step back in time. Dressed in traditional Korean hanbok, we explore the grand Gyeongbokgung Palace and the UNESCO World Heritage Site of Changdeokgung Palace. We also stroll through Bukchon Hanok Village, where centuries-old Korean architecture still survives in the heart of the city. PART 3: UNDERSTANDING KOREA To understand modern South Korea, you have to understand its history and culture. We visit the Korean War Memorial and Museum to learn about the events that shaped the nation. Then we dive into Korean culture through a hands-on cooking class and some unforgettable Korean food experiences. PART 4: THE FUN NEVER STOPS Finally, we experience the energy and excitement of Seoul's famous markets. From the incredible street food of Gwangjang Market to the endless stalls of Namdaemun Market, we discover why food, shopping, and community are such an important part of life in Seoul.
